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$897 per month in Sveti Nikole vs $802 in Kavadarci, rent included.

A couple spends around $1,379 per month in Sveti Nikole vs $1,224 in Kavadarci, rent included.

A family of three spends $1,860 per month in Sveti Nikole vs $1,646 in Kavadarci, rent included.

Sveti Nikole costs about 12% more than Kavadarci, driven mainly by Eating Out.

Both Sveti Nikole and Kavadarci are more affordable than the global median – Sveti Nikole 35% lower, Kavadarci 42% lower.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$326 in Sveti Nikole versus $224 in Kavadarci.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

Salaries run about 11% higher in Kavadarci, which reinforces the cost advantage – you earn more and spend less. Purchasing power leans clearly in its favor.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$35.00 in Sveti Nikole versus $28.00 in Kavadarci.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$188 vs $178 – making Kavadarci the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
